life is in motion, it never stops. even when we rest our bodies, something within us is still going, still working. life is also a cycle. like a wheel in constant motion, our life cycles in and out of stages, some fast, some slow.
take care of your wheel. patch the pieces of your life that may cause your wheel to lose longevity, stress takes away from your life, your happiness. secure your wheel to its foundation, always find your balance and always come back to being grounded and humble. over your lifetime, you will face many things, but focus on always being fluid. too much restriction can cause damage, likewise too much freedom can also cause damage. let your wheel see all that life has to offer.
where have you been lately? is your cup half full, or half empty? do you feel limited, or too free? or do you have balance?
i have been living in my head lately, watching and listening to the things i do, say, think, and feel. my cup is half full. i am living in my blessings, things are changing in my life. if you have read any of my previous posts, i always mention this change. i love change. i feel balanced, not too limited and not too free.
life is full of opportunities, like water there may be barriers such as pipes, drinking glasses, sea shores, and so forth. these barriers are needed to maintain the water, and such things as your religion, morals, and values may help you maintain your character, your life. but, if there is small debris in the pipes, not enough room in the drinking glass, and the tide is too strong for the sea shore, the water will flow, molding itself to whatever is in its path, always pushing through, finding its way.
be like water, be flexible and adaptable. be natural, be curious with respect to your values. find interest in life. make decisions, whether good or bad, accept the consequences and move forward. water flows in a cycle as well. think about it, all the water in the world is connected in some way. water flows from reservoirs, to lakes, to rivers, to bays, to oceans. maybe not in this order, but you get the point. water freezes, water melts, water evaporates, always changing and developing. water makes up a lot of things, water has so many qualities. announce yourself, the unique you. everyday is another chance to be the best you.
